Mark Kosters Engineering Status Report. Engineering Theme 2012 success is being aided by contractors (but not as many) An age for new engineers Lots of.

Slides:



Advertisements
Similar presentations
ARIN Update NANOG 55 – 6 June 2012 Mark Kosters Chief Technology Officer, ARIN.
Advertisements

ARIN Update Leslie Nobile Director, Registration Services.
RPKI Certificate Policy Status Update Stephen Kent.
ARINs RESTful Provisioning Interface Tim Christensen.
Nigel Titley. RIPE 54, 9 May 2007, Tallinn, Estonia. 1 RIPE NCC Certification Task Force Update Presented by Nigel Titley RIPE NCC.
ARIN Update Aaron Hughes ARIN Board of Trustees Focus IPv4 Depletion & IPv6 Uptake Developing, adapting, and enhancing processes and procedures.
IPv4 Depletion IPv6 Adoption 3 February /8s Remaining.
Leslie Nobile APNIC 30 ARIN Update Focus Continue development and integration of web based system (ARIN Online) Outreach on IPv4 depletion and IPv6.
Projects Awaiting Prioritization Nate Davis. Planned Functionality Projects underway or next in queue Hosted RPKI (Planned 2012 Q2 Deployment) - RPKI.
What’s Next: DNSSEC & RPKI Mark Kosters. Why are DNSSEC and RPKI Important Two critical resources – DNS – Routing Hard to tell when it is compromised.
ARIN Online Users Forum. Overview Purpose and Players Brief overview of how ARIN sets priorities Usage statistics Review of the ARIN Online user survey.
Paul Vixie APNIC 32 – Busan, Korea ARIN Update Focus IPv4 Depletion & IPv6 Uptake Developing, adapting, and improving processes and procedures Working.
ARIN Update LACNIC XVI Leslie Nobile Director, Registration Services.
Engineering Report Mark Kosters, CTO. Engineering Theme Continue to work on a surge Lots of work to do Supplementing staff with contractors.
Resource Certification What it means for LIRs Alain P. AINA Special Project Manager.
Introduction to ARIN and the Internet Registry System.
Reverse DNS Delegations, Templates and RWS Andy Newton Chief Engineer.
1 ARIN: Mission, Role and Services John Curran ARIN President and CEO.
Changes at ARIN—Not your Grandpa’s RIR anymore (RPKI, DNSSEC, etc.) Andy Newton Chief Engineer.
Engineering Report Andy Newton (in lieu of Mark Kosters)
Technical Area Report Byron Ellacott Technical Area Manager.
Software Development Update Nate Davis, Chief Operating Officer.
1 San Diego, California 25 February Automating Your Interactions with ARIN Mark Kosters Chief Technology Officer.
1 San Diego, California 25 February Securing Routing: RPKI Overview Mark Kosters Chief Technology Officer.
ACSP Report – Review of Open Suggestions Nate Davis.
RPKI Tutorial Andy Newton Chief Engineer, ARIN. Agenda Resource Public Key Infrastructure(RPKI) Route Origin Authorizations (ROAs) Certificate Authorities.
Registration Services Department Richard Jimmerson.
Engineering Report Mark Kosters. Big changes with Engineering Lots of requests for development/operations support The Board heard you Engineering growing.
ARIN Engineering Mark Kosters. Engineering Theme Continue to work on a surge Lots of work to do (but a great deal now done) Supplementing staff with contractors.
Database Update Kaveh Ranjbar Database Department Manager, RIPE NCC.
Whois-RWS: A RESTful Web Service for WHOIS Andy Newton, Chief Engineer.
1 ARIN and the RIR System: Mission, Role and Services Life After IPv4 Depletion Jon Worley –Analyst Paul Andersen ARIN Board of Trustees.
APNIC Update AfriNIC 12 May 2010 Sanjaya Services Director, APNIC.
ARIN Update Leslie Nobile Director, Registration Services.
Regional Internet Registries Statistics & Activities IETF 55 Atlanta Prepared By APNIC, ARIN, LACNIC, RIPE NCC.
Technical Area Report Byron Ellacott Technical Area Manager.
REST & Relax: The future of Whois and Templates at ARIN Andy Newton, Chief Engineer.
2016 Services Roadmap APNIC Services George Kuo 9 September 2015 Jakarta.
API Software and Tools Andy Newton, Chief Engineer.
John Curran APNIC 29 5 March 2010 ARIN Update. 4-byte ASN Stats In 2009 – Received 197 requests for 4-byte ASNs – 140 changed request to 2-byte – ARIN.
Engineering Report Mark Kosters. Staffing Tim Christensen QA Manager – Passed away August 5, 2014 – Worked for ARIN for 14 years DBA System Architect.
Fees and Services John Curran President and CEO. Situation Fee Structure Review Panel completed and discharged – Final Fee Structure Review Report released.
1 Madison, Wisconsin 9 September14. 2 Security Overlays on Core Internet Protocols – DNSSEC and RPKI Mark Kosters ARIN Engineering.
Engineering Report Mark Kosters. Big changes with Engineering starting at the beginning of 2015 Lots of requests for development/operations support Engineering.
Sprint 106 Review / Sprint 107 Planning May 06, 2013.
Software Development Update Nate Davis, Chief Operating Officer.
ARIN Update RIPE 66 Leslie Nobile Director, Registration Services.
Engineering Report Mark Kosters. Staffing Operations – 7 operations engineers + 2 managers (AT FULL STRENGTH) Development – 8 programmers + manager (AT.
Sprint 105 Review / Sprint 106 Planning April 22, 2013.
New Features and Upcoming Features in ARIN Online Andy Newton, Chief Engineer.
RDAP Andy Newton, Chief Engineer. Background WHOIS (Port 43) – Old, very old – Lot’s of problems Under specified, no I18N, insecure, no authentication,
Engineering Report Mark Kosters. Engineering Theme 2012 success is being aided by contractors (but not near as many) We have one ARIN FTE slot open Lots.
Software Development Update Nate Davis, Chief Operating Officer.
Mark Kosters Engineering Status Report. Engineering Theme 2011 success was aided by contractors Lots of work yet to do (but a great deal now done) An.
Registration Services Richard Jimmerson. RSD Team Transfer Services Manager Cathy Clements Resource Services Manager Lisa Liedel Technical Services Manager.
Engineering Report Mark Kosters, CTO. Engineering Theme Working on a Surge Lots of work to do Supplementing staff with contractors.
APNIC Status Report RIPE 44 Amsterdam, The Netherlands January 27-31, 2003.
Engineering Update Key Projects –IPV6 Registration function is completed, tested, and ready for production IPV6 WHOIS completed, tested, and ready for.
Pending ACSP Report Mark Kosters, CTO. ACSP Suggestion WHOWAS service (submitted June 2008) /suggestions/ html.
Community Captioner. Team CC Ely Lerner Team Lead (Amgen) Jeffrey Chan Chaitanya Ramavajjala Chetan Sharma Raed Shomali Team Members (USC)
APNIC Update Elly Tawhai Senior Internet Resource Analyst/Liaison Officer, Pacific, APNIC AusNOG
Software Development Update Nate Davis, Chief Operating Officer.
Registration Services Richard Jimmerson. RSD Core Functions IPv4, IPv6, and ASN requests Change of Authority Services – ORG & POC recovery – Transfers.
Update from the RIPE NCC Axel Pawlik Managing Director.
Software Development Update Nate Davis, Chief Operating Officer.
Delegated RPKI / ARIN Command Line
Engineering Report Mark Kosters.
Registration Services Update
ARIN Update John Curran President and CEO.
Presentation transcript:

Mark Kosters Engineering Status Report

Engineering Theme 2012 success is being aided by contractors (but not as many) An age for new engineers Lots of work done, much more to do 2

Staffing Operations – 6 People + Manager – (one slot open) Development – 5 Developers + Manager – 5 Contractors (down 2 since ARINXXVIII) Quality Assurance – 3 QA + Manager – 4 Contractors Project Management – 1 (slot open) Management – 1 (me) 3

Operations Upgrading end-of-life equipment Rolled out Anycast – Running now in St Maartin, San Jose, and Ashburn – Soon in Toronto Maintaining the various environments we have running (Production/OT&E/Dev/QA/Staging) Close to running https version of Whois-RWS IT Support RPKI rollout 4

Whois-RWS Traffic Loads Have had a pretty good run – Multiple highs in 2010 and 2011 Today – Running “normally” now at 475 queries per second – RESTful calls have overtaken port 43 calls 1.8 Billion RESTful calls for March 1.2 Billion Port 43 queries 5

Whois-RWS Statistics Queries on Port 43 Months Queries Per Second 6

Whois-RWS Statistics Queries Months Queries Per Second

Whois-RWS – IPv6 Total Per Month Month 8

Development/QA Improvements to existing systems ARIN Online releases since ARIN XXVIII – Invoice reminders now in ARIN Online – Implementation of Policy Huge implications on DNS zone generation No longer creating delegations at a /20 boundary – WhoWas – Moving to newer JAVA concepts – Various Whois-RWS improvements and ACSP requests 9

Current Tasks Moving from Red Hat JBoss to JBoss AS7 – Cost reduction measure – Lots of improvements to internal frameworks Home-stretch for Hosted RPKI – Working on loose ends and documentation – Embedding the CPS URL in certificates currently break two of the three existing validators 10

Upcoming Tasks for 2012 Deploy hosted RPKI Implement delegated RPKI (up/down) Moving from Oracle to open source database – Cost reduction measure Moving off Red Hat OS – Cost reduction again IPv4 runout changes Integrated payments 11

How is ARIN Online used? 54,196 accounts activated by Q1 of 2012 since inception Number of Accounts Activated * Through Q1 of

Active Usage of ARIN Online # of Users Times Logged In 13

Management of POCs Since April, 2011 Includes POCs created via SWiPs 14

Management of Orgs Since April, 2011 Includes Orgs created via SWiPs ARIN Online208 Templates12 Org Deletes 15

Net Record Management Since April, 2011 Similar to Org Modify All requests made via ARIN Online

Reg-RWS (RESTful Provisioning) Since April, 2011 Transactions 17

Evolution/Development of Services Briefly look at three services – How introduced – Participation – Feedback WhoWas RPKI Whois -> Whois-RWS 18

WhoWas Requests Demo Period – 9 inquiries – 1 actually used the system Production – 45 authorized users – 125 requests – Most active user: 66 requests 19

RPKI Pilot Pilot period – Operational since 7/2009 – 63 users – 76 ROAs in the pilot Instructions on how to use – – Includes the TAL! Services are hooked into the pilot – RIPE validator 20

RPKI Progress on Production Services Huge challenge developing against IBM HSM has been overcome – Working with a secured embedded device – The attached host is a RPKI generator – The HSM is a RPKI validator Estimated to have first part in production in 2012 – Will require RSA or LRSA to participate Protocol is mature – kind of – Validators do not allow for extension that we require (certificate policies extension) – Rsync may not be the best protocol to retrieve data from repositories 21

RPKI Challenges Delegated is up next Distribution protocol changes (Rsync verses http or ?) Publication Protocol ERX and Inter-RIR transfers Merging with the Global Trust Anchor Simultaneous Operation of RIR Trust Anchor and Global Trust Anchor 22

Whois circa 2007 Whois was at the end of life – Extremely expensive to run and maintain – No real-time updates Need a replacement Need to add CIDR query support Need a way to handle change 23

Whois-RWS Andy came up with a RESTful interface Added real-time updates Added way to evolve features via REST Other RIRs are following along 24

Whois-RWS Today A working Group is chartered for both names and numbers (WEIRDS) Security and other committees within ICANN is pushing for a replacement to WHOIS - SSAC, Whois review team, Internationalized Whois WG, etc. ICANN sees this work as a way to move away from Whois 25

Retrospective ARIN has matured and come a long way since fall of 2007 – Lots of core stuff ignored for too long – Example database was Oracle 8 on Solaris 8 Solaris 8 released in 2000 Oracle 8 end of life was 2004/6 – Software deployments were impossibly hard – No real interactive website 26

ARIN Today Almost complete rewrite Additional functionality – Reg-RWS – Whois-RWS – DNSSEC – Security (API-Keys) IRR feature set – Now at par with other IRR’s for functionality (using templates) 27

Where this puts us With the core completed… – Items modified, documented, tested, and deployed with confidence – Bolt on things faster (WhoWas took 3 months) 28

Schedule Challenges Planned Functionality for 2011 – Hosted RPKI – Delegated RPKI – Managing unmet IPv4 requests – Payment integration – SWIP Easy – Migration off of Red Hat and Oracle 29

Schedule Challenges Unplanned Functionality – Extended stats for NRO – DNSSEC improvements – Streamlined Transfer Service – CMSD membership/voter functionality – Integration of IRR within ARIN Online – Lame delegation reporting – Additional OT&E services – Alternative RPKI-like services – Retrievable meeting registration data 30

Schedule Challenges Community Needs/Policy – Ways to better vet/implement community needs – Need to hear from you Technical and Operational Debt – Many existing internal processes are inefficient and labor intensive – Software changes Thought Leadership – Whois-RWS – RPKI – Research 31

Comments? 32